Concerns about punching shear in a flat slab
This report concerns potential shear failures in flat slabs. This originates from inconsistent design and detailing of the shear reinforcement where a proprietary shear link system is assumed in the design but not followed in detailing.

Wall tie design between masonry panels and timber frames
This report discusses the potential for failure of timber frame wall ties between masonry and timber in moderate to high wind conditions.

Collapsed scaffolding
A reporter highlights how, following modest levels of snow fall in the winter, scaffolding erected in order to support a temporary roof collapsed inwards.
